It can be said that Koreans work miracles with little. Experience and a very prolific industry. Most of the time, the difference in quality is not noticeable. In fact, many of the dramas have aesthetic qualities not seen elsewhere. Whether it's the way of shooting or the atmosphere. But it becomes difficult when it comes to producing shows that encroach on the specialization of Westerners. Such as big action scenes. There's also a difficulty in grasping this type of action. The philosophy is reminiscent of older western series, when the scenes were less realistic.

As an example the Vagabond drama. The action scenes are good (in fact, they are better than Western scenes in terms of suspense and tension, but less good from a technical and realistic point of view). There is, however, a problem of seriousness. One scene shows the characters in a car (ordinary, without armor). They are being shot at by several enemies, at medium distance, from a high position, equipped with assault rifles. The car is pierced with bullets. In such a situation, no occupant of the car could have survived. But the drama uses the (now outdated) cliché of the car as armor. It is true that the trajectory of a high velocity ammunition is not always straight or sometimes fails to penetrate a passenger compartment. But not a flood of bullets as shown in the scene. Especially since a large number of bullets could pass through the windows. So there is a naive and outdated side to some blockbuster action scenes. Whereas action scenes are better in historical dramas, even with almost supernatural movements.
Afterwards, in the case of the Vagabond, it is possible that there is a parodic side, because the screenwriters are great jokers, and they often have an offbeat sense of humor.
